About the Role
We are looking for an enthusiastic and committed Healthcare Assistant to join our team.
Healthcare Assistants are instrumental in providing care to patients and supporting the clinical team.
As a Healthcare Assistant you will assist nursing staff with patient care (including personal care and patient watch) whilst maintaining a safe and clean work environment on the ward.
About the Service
Our service is a busy ward providing care for our acute general surgery patients, undergoing general surgical procedures within the ward environment and high-dependency surgical patients in our 8 bed Surgical Progressive Care Unit (SPCU).
